Why is there no hot water coming out?

Why is there no hot water coming out?

A water heater that produces no hot water may not be getting power, may have a tripped limit switch, or may have one or more failed heating elements. First, check the water heater’s circuit breaker in the service panel to make sure it hasn’t tripped. If the breaker has tripped, switch it off, then switch it back on.

What to do if your electric water heater is not heating?

If the heating element is not heating when activated, replace the heating element. If your electric water heater runs out of hot water quickly, or if the water isn’t as hot as it should be, the heating element could be the problem.

Why does my hot water heater keep running out?

One of your two heating elements could be broken, causing your hot water to run out faster than it should. Or you could have a broken thermostat. Why is the gas valve on my water heater not opening?

It detects whether your pilot light is lit by generating a small electrical current powered by the heat of the pilot flame. The gas valve won’t open if it doesn’t sense the small electrical current produced by the thermocouple because it assumes the pilot light is off.
